Noella Wiyaala Nwadei[1] (known under de stage name Wiyaala; born 22 December 1986) be a Ghanaian Afro-pop singer-songwriter wey dey sing insyd ein native language Sissala den Waala dialects den English, often dey combine all three languages within ein songs.[2] Wiyaala dey mean "de doer" insyd de Sissala dialect.[3] She achieve fame plus ein single "Make Me Dance"[4][5][6] den ein androgynous image.[7] After she make ein name insyd reality shows insyd Accra, na she establish a solo career insyd 2013 plus de hit single "Rock My Body", (na Van Calebs initiate dance move)[8] wich win am two awards at de 2014 first edition of de All Africa Music Awards,[9] de Most Promising Artiste insyd Africa den Revelation of The African Continent. Wiyaala sanso associate plus UNICEF Ghana den de Ministry of Gender, Children and Social Protection ein campaigns against child marriage, child poverty, health den sanitation. She headline de 15th London African Music Festival insyd London.[10] Insyd March 2021, na she be among de Top 30 Most Influential Women insyd Music by de 3Music Awards Women's Brunch.[11]

Life den career

[edit | edit source]

Early life

[edit | edit source]

Na dem born Noella Wiyaala insyd Wa, Upper West Ghana as one of four sistos[12] wey she grow up insyd Funsi den Tumu. She get first singing lessons from ein mommie, a choir singer insyd de local church,[13] wey na she perform ever since she dey 5 years old.[14] Ein surname, wich she pick for a stage name, wey dey mean "de doer" insyd ein native Sisaala language.[14] During ein late teenage years, na she play football as a midfielder.[15] She attend Kanton Secondary School insyd Tumu, wer na she acquire a reputation for she be a tom-boy, dey play football wey na she be in demand as a dancer den entertainer insyd school productions. She sanso attend Takoradi Polytechnic wey na she study art den design .[16][17]

Insyd 2018, na Wiyaala disclose insyd an interview plus Becky on de E with Becks show on Joy Prime say na she marry for four years buh she no go disclose de name of ein husby. Four people per wey be present at ein wedding; a lawyer, a judge den ein mum den dad.[18]

Films den television

[edit | edit source]

Wiyaala make ein TV acting debut insyd late 2013 insyd de Viasat 1 hit comedy series MultiKoloured.[19]

Insyd February 2016 Wiyaala make ein movie debut insyd de Ghanaian feature film No Man’s Land.[20] wey for wich na she be nominated as de Golden Discovery 2016 at de Golden Movie Awards.

Fashion

[edit | edit source]

Na Wiyaala get nominated "Female Personality of the Year" at de 2014 Ghana's Fashion Icon Awards, plus a dress wey einself sketch den design.[21][22] She dey design ein stage dresses den jewellery[23] to showcase de culture of de people from ein home region.[24] She sanso be recognised for ein style by winning de Best Individual Style Award at de Glitz 2015 Style Awards.

Dem recognize am for ein sense of fashion, stage dressing den style, Wiyaala be influential thru out de world plus Hong Kong's South China Morning Post cite am as a role model.[25]

Philanthropy

[edit | edit source]

Wiyaala make ein intentions clear to recruit, groom, den sponsor young talents from Funsi den ein surroundings as ein way of giving back to society.[26] She build an Arts and Culture Center insyd ein community.[27]
